Table 1 Current status of selected endoscopic bariatric therapies
| Device | Procedure | Mechanism | Regulatory status |
| Orbera | Intragastric balloon | Space-occupying device | FDA-approved |
| Integrated dual balloon | Intragastric balloon | Space-occupying device | FDA-approved |
| OverStitch | Endoscopic sleeve gastroplasty | Gastric remodeling | FDA-approved1 |
| Incisionless operating platform | Primary obesity surgery endolumenal | Gastric remodeling | Under FDA review |
| Articulating circular endoscopic stapler | Gastroplasty | Gastric remodeling | In human trials |
| AspireAssist | Aspiration therapy | Aspiration | FDA-approved |
| Self-assembling magnets | Endoscopic enteral anastomosis | Dual-path enteral bypass | In human trials |
| OverStitch | Transoral outlet reduction for revision of gastric bypass | Anastomotic reduction | FDA-approved1 |
| Incisionless operating platform | Revision obesity surgery endolumenal for revision of gastric bypass | Anastomotic and pouch reduction | FDA-approved1 |
